Glastonbury announces 2017 line-up

The line-up for this year's Glastonbury festival has been revealed this morning, with acts ranging from Run The Jewels to The Jacksons to Katy Perry

Feature by The Skinny | 30 Mar 2017

As usual, the line-up is packed with bands and acts from right across the map. The hip-hop highlights include incendiary duo Run The Jewels and the uber-prolific Anderson .Paak, while UK grime aces Stormzy, Dizzee Rascal and Wiley also feature. Solange, Angel Olsen and Laura Marling are also on the bill, alongside returning indie mainstays Future Islands and The National.

The festival's tradition of adding a host of musical legends to the bill continues; this year's slots are filled by Bee Gees lynchpin Barry Gibb, The Jacksons, Chic and Kris Kristofferson. The new additions join the previously-announced headline trio of Radiohead, Ed Sheeran and Foo Fighters.

After this year's festival, the Glastonbury site of Worthy Farm will be given a break for a couple of years. There will be no festival in 2018, and then, in an interesting turn of events, the festival will go by the name "The Variety Bazaar" for the 2019 edition, which will take place on a new temporary site in the Midlands.
